學(xué)Java編程語(yǔ)言對(duì)于很多人來(lái)說(shuō)是比較好的,因?yàn)镴ava的就業(yè)崗位還是比較多的。Java與c都屬于計(jì)算機(jī)的高級(jí)編程語(yǔ)言,不同的是,Java是一種面向?qū)ο蟮恼Z(yǔ)言,C是一門(mén)面向過(guò)程的語(yǔ)言。
Java只需要編譯一次,就可以在不同的平臺(tái)上面運(yùn)行,對(duì)于C來(lái)說(shuō),如果在Windows上面編譯生成的文件只能在window上運(yùn)行,如果想要在Linux系統(tǒng)下運(yùn)行,需要重新在Linux下面進(jìn)行編譯,所以Java還是有一定的優(yōu)勢(shì)。
Java和C的主要用途也不一樣,Java主要針對(duì)的是互聯(lián)網(wǎng)應(yīng)用的開(kāi)發(fā),而C主要偏向于底層的開(kāi)發(fā)。所以現(xiàn)在我們所看到的操作系統(tǒng),智能設(shè)備這些都是使用的C;而我們平時(shí)的一些大數(shù)據(jù)平臺(tái)、網(wǎng)站開(kāi)發(fā),比如我們經(jīng)常使用的電商網(wǎng)站,還有一些企業(yè)管理網(wǎng)站等都是使用Java。
我們可以根據(jù)自己的職業(yè)發(fā)展選擇適合的編程語(yǔ)言學(xué)習(xí),不過(guò)目前就從就業(yè)崗位來(lái)說(shuō),很多人會(huì)選擇學(xué)習(xí)Java編程,就業(yè)機(jī)會(huì)也是多一點(diǎn)。